Maximizing Efficiency with Palletizing Robots in Manufacturing
In the realm of manufacturing and packaging machinery, the introduction of palletizing robots marks a significant advancement in how products are handled and organized. These automated systems are designed to streamline the process of loading and unloading goods onto pallets, which plays a crucial role in preparing products for storage and shipment. By leveraging the capabilities of palletizing robots, manufacturers can achieve remarkable improvements in efficiency, safety, and quality control.
Palletizing robots are equipped with advanced technology that enables them to perform complex tasks with precision. These robots can handle various types of products, including boxes, bags, and containers, making them highly versatile in different manufacturing settings. Their ability to consistently and accurately stack items reduces the risk of human error and enhances the overall quality of the packaging process.
One of the most significant advantages of using palletizing robots is the increase in productivity. These systems can operate continuously without the need for breaks, allowing for higher throughput and faster completion of orders. By automating the palletizing process, companies can reallocate human resources to more strategic tasks, such as quality control and oversight, which can lead to better overall operational efficiency.
Additionally, palletizing robots contribute to improved workplace safety. The repetitive nature of manual palletizing can lead to worker fatigue and increase the risk of workplace injuries. By implementing robotic systems, manufacturers can minimize these risks, creating a safer environment for their employees. Furthermore, the ergonomic design of these robots ensures that heavy lifting is managed by machines rather than human workers, reducing strain and injury.
Cost-effectiveness is another important factor to consider. While the initial investment in palletizing robots may seem substantial, the long-term savings generated through increased productivity and reduced labor costs often offset this expense. Furthermore, these robots can significantly decrease material waste and improve the accuracy of inventory management, further contributing to overall cost savings.
In conclusion, palletizing robots are an invaluable asset in the manufacturing and packaging industries. By enhancing productivity, improving safety, and offering a cost-effective solution to product handling, these automated systems are transforming the way goods are prepared for shipment. As the demand for efficiency and quality in production continues to rise, the role of palletizing robots will undoubtedly become even more pivotal in shaping the future of manufacturing. Embracing this technology will not only streamline operations but also position businesses for success in an increasingly competitive market.
